RAJESH BHARDWAJ, J.(ORAL) Instant petition has been filed under Section 482 Cr.P.C. praying for issuance of directions to fairly conclude the investigation in case FIR No.156, dated 15.10.2021, under Sections 323, 342, 354-B, 34 IPC, registered at Police Station Kartarpur, District Jalandhar Rural. It has been submitted by counsel for the petitioner that FIR was registered on 15.10.2021 and thereafter for the reasons best known to it, the Investigating Agency is not proceeding with the investigation and hence the same is pending investigation till date.

Notice of motion.

On the asking of the Court, Ms.Sakshi Bakshi, AAG, Punjab, who is present in Court, accepts notice on behalf of the official respondents. Heard.
